Michael Shea, PhD, has taught somatic psychology, myofascial release, visceral manipulation, and craniosacral therapy worldwide for nearly three decades. One of the Upledger Institute's first certified Full Instructors of CranioSacral Therapy, and a cofounder of the International Affiliation of Biodynamic Trainings, he lives in Juno Beach, FL.
